Abstract :
A pair of novel TbIII-based enantiomers, [Tb(dbm)3·LSS] (1) and [Tb(dbm)3·LRR] (2) (where LSS=(+)-4,5-pinene bipyridine, LRR= (-)-4,5-pinene bipyridine, dbm=dibenzoylmethanate), were synthesized and characterized based on single crystal X-ray diffraction, elemental analysis, FT-IR, TG and CD spectra. X-ray diffraction analysis showed that both the complexes crystallized in monoclinic crystal system with P21 chiral space group. The TbIII ion was eight-coordinated by six O atoms of three dbm ligands and two N atoms from one chiral ligand LSS or LRR. The CD spectra revealed that complexes 1 and 2 were enantiomers. Thermogravimetric analysis results indicated that 1 and 2 were thermally stable up to 246 °C.
